Dahlias are … WebOnce late Autumn hits and the first frosts arrive, it's a good time to bring your potted Dahlias inside for storage over the winter. You will need some secateurs and, if you have a fair few pots, possibly some crates for storage. A cool, dry shed or greenhouse is perfect, but a dry spot under a bench on the patio will probably be fine as well. campbell town private hospital

Lay the tubers on several … Web17 mrt. 2024 · First, cut the dahlia stems off five to six inches above the ground. Carefully dig the dahlias out of the ground using a gardening fork. Pick the plants up using the stems as a handle and shake as much soil off as possible. Then use your fingers to remove as much soil as you can from between the tubers.

Web21 apr. 2024 · Cut off the foliage and carefully dig out the tubers. Brush off excess dirt and let the tubers dry for a few days. If possible, hang them upside down when drying …

Web19 nov. 2015 · Keep the temperature at 40-50 degrees at all times during winter storage. The humidity should be kept medium-high to keep tubers from drying and shriveling.
